PM tells a fisherman: “Do not raise your voice at me!”

By Thai PBS

 

4B3EFB06-5FEE-4ED1-BEF0-B7DACF88B91B.jpe

 

Prime Minister Prayut Chan-o-cha yelled at a fisherman who raised his voice apparently to get his attention as he was explaining the latter’s question about fishing problem during his meeting with local people in Nong Chik district of Pattani on Monday.

 

While observing an exhibition held at the central livestock market in Nong Chik district as a sideline of the mobile cabinet meeting, an unidentified man approached the prime minister with a petition for the government to amend fishing regulation allowing fishing boats to fish only 220 days in a year. He wanted the fishing period to be extended so fishermen will have more income to cope with their expenses.

 

As the prime minister was explaining his problem while many local residents were listening, the fishermen raised his voice to interrupt him, prompting him to yell back: “Be patient, do not raise your voice at me. Do you understand? I am listening to you, you can speak as normal, thank you.”
